Monte-Carlo Wine Festival:
International Wine Tasting – Wine, Culture and Life
Staff Writer – January 31, 2008

On February 23, 24, and 25, 2008, at the prestigious Hotel Méridien Beach Plaza of Monte-Carlo, in the elegant environment of the Principality of Monaco, the first Monte-Carlo Wine Festival takes place.

Hotel Méridien Beach Plaza Hotel Méridien Beach Plaza, Monte-Carlo, Principality of Monaco

The Monte-Carlo Wine Festival is an upscale wine tasting event, created for some of the best European vitivinicultural productions, with guided tastings, workshops and wine market analyses.

The festival offers an upscale location and serious business opportunities to producers, international distributors, and all professionals dealing with the wine world. It is also a golden opportunity for educated wine lovers, who will get the chance to taste exceptional wines, to develop a network of new wine contacts, while getting the up-to-date news and trends of this important sector.

The MCWF mission is to emphasize vitiviniculture and gastronomy as a whole, while showcasing the participating producers, so that their technical know-how and their products take center stage for three days. To this end, in addition to qualified local and international buyers and distributors, the organizers have invited hotel and restaurant professionals, enological associations, professional sommeliers and, of course, the local and international press.

In addition to tasting, the first MCWF agenda includes various eno-cultural activities. The goal is to highlight the links between enology and culture, emphasizing how wine is a typical fruit of the 'Evolving Art of the Earth', and at the same time take a look at the state of the industry and what the future may bring to the wine world.

Among the many MCWF side activities there are:

  • SCATTIDIVINI Photo Exhibition
    Landscapes and visual vitivinicultural stories to highlight the vitivinicultural activity, wine, and the man and women who produce it.
  • Scripta Manent - Wine and Food Library of the Principality of Monaco.
    Exhibition of antique and rare wine and food books from the collection of Liana and Mauro Marabini.
  • The MCWF through the Eyes of Art
    DVD realized by artist Renato Missaglia, featuring the places and labels of the producers participating in the festival.
  • "Mediterranean Gastronomy and Wine Pairing"
    Round Table with the participation of Michele Florentino, MCWF President, and H. E. René Novella, Secretary of State of the Principality of Monaco.
  • "Wine in History"
    Moderated by Professor, Leonardo Saviano, of the Naples University and General Secretary of the Ordine Costantiniano (Order of Constantine).
  • "Sommelier: One Profession, One Lifestyle, One Passion"
    Moderated by Jean-Pierre Rous, Maître sommelier, head of Convivium - Slow Food Southeast France-Monaco
  • "Notes Among the Vines" - Music-therapy techniques in viticulture.
    Conference by Dr. Carlo Cignozzi, of Azienda Agricola Paradiso di Frassino.
